A UN commission uncovers widespread sectarian violence by government-affiliated factions in Syria’s coast, highlighting the dangerous consequences of a fractured state amid ongoing civil war.

In a sobering revelation that underscores the perilous state of Syria's ongoing conflict, a United Nations-backed investigative commission has confirmed “widespread and systematic” attacks on civilians by factions affiliated with Syria’s former regime.
